This file focusses on various prospectuses published under the headmastership of Walter Lee Sargant in the early 20th century.

A prospectus promoting studying at Oakham School in 1902. Contents: Trustees & Staff; Subjects; Upper School & Lower School; Examinations; Boarding Houses; Library, Games & Extras; Terms; Holidays; Infectious Disease; Scholarships, Exhibitions & Prizes. Three double-pages A to C.

This series focuses on the Day girls' house of Hambleton, founded in 1997. The main items are informal photographs of house events and house diaries, planning and detailing the house routine throughout the years.

This series focuses on the boarding girls in Rushebrookes house. It was named after the first School Headmaster, Robert Rushbrooke. The first girls moved in in the Spring term 1980 but the building was officially open only on 22 November 1980. This series contains items related to the daily life of the girls in school and in house, as well as house photographs, mostly from the 2010s.
